BN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2022 in Review

642 of the 6,221 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Brookfield (BN) for Q4 2022, worth a combined $29.6B — down 24% from $39B a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 115 funds closed out of BN and 83 opened new positions — a net loss of 32 holders — while 493 trimmed existing stakes and 65 added.

The largest buyer was Select Equity Group, opening a new position worth an estimated $73.5M. The largest seller was Bank of Montreal, cutting an estimated $1.98B.
